1. An ethics commission member may be removed from office for: a. Substantial neglect of duty; b. Gross misconduct in office; c. Violation of the commission's code of ethics; or d. Willful or habitual neglect or refusal to perform the duties of the member. 2. Removal of an ethics commission member under subsection 1 requires agreement by a majority of: a. The governor; b. The majority leader of the senate; and c. The minority leader of the senate.
